An occupational therapist reviews handwriting samples.
An occupational therapist reviews handwriting samples, completes standardized fine motor speed test, evaluates 6 areas of handwriting ( spacing between word and letters, letter alignment, letter size, letter closure and letter overlap), alphabet letter formation from memory, letter reversal screening, handwriting speed, pencil grasp and posture.
Standardized tests may include any of the following tests:
Jordan Right Left Reversal Test-3rd edition
Activities include: specific program tailored to each student with worksheets, dry erase boards, playdoh, multi-sensory techniques, handwriting games

Evaluates child on their skills for memory recall, organizational skills, timeliness, self-control, following multi-step directions, perseverance, attention to task via parent and child interview and rating scale.
Includes 30 minute sessions that teach children the skills for memory recall, organizational skills, timeliness, self-control, following multi-step directions, perseverance, attention to task and focus better. It has take home tools for parents and children to use in their daily life. Recommended for 3rd grade to adult.
